ChatGPT and Gemini, I'm shifting my position after this debate.
Agreement: Gong, Chorus, Outreach, and Salesloft are clearly the top 4. All three of us have these (in various orders), and they represent the core of AI-powered sales: conversation intelligence + engagement automation.
Where I'm conceding:
Gemini is right about Apollo.io over Clari for this list. While Clari is powerful for revenue ops, Apollo's AI-driven prospecting and top-of-funnel automation fills a critical gap the other four don't address. It's more directly in the "AI sales tool" category than Clari's forecasting focus.
ChatGPT, ExecVision is too niche. Gemini nailed it — we need broad impact for a definitive top 5. Apollo offers more comprehensive value.
My updated reasoning:
- Gong (#1): Best conversation intelligence
- Chorus (#2): Strong CI + ZoomInfo integration
- Outreach/Salesloft (#3-4): Engagement platform leaders (order debatable)
- Apollo (#5): Essential AI prospecting/top-of-funnel
This covers the full sales cycle with AI: prospecting → engagement → conversation analysis.
